Western Way is in Basingstoke and in Basingstoke And Deane district. RG22 6DF is located in the South Ham elect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Basingstoke.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Western Way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Western Way was 297.7 per 1,000 residents, which is 180.4% higher than the South Ham average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Western Way has the 4th highest crime rate of 27 local areas in South Ham and the 19th highest crime rate of 580 local areas in Basingstoke and Deane .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 141.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-38.4%.
